Happy Birthday to Mary Blair

Today is the 100th Birthday of Mary Blair -- she is everything I aspire to. Today google decided to do it right, and I've been staring lovingly at this doodle for far too long.
A few years ago I took a private meeting with an art dealer while I was in California. We discussed a 6x8" Peter Pan original. At the time they were offering it up at 15K. I pretended I was on the fence while staring at it in the only way I have ever been absolutely 'agog.' At that moment I knew, that some day, one of her pieces would be mine, but not today... or probably tomorrow. I have that goal at the proper top of my bucket list though, and I'll keep you up today on the pursuit of such happiness as I aspire to it.

In the meantime I console myself with my 1st edition  copy of "I Can Fly". Lucky for you they reissued this a few years ago and you can snag a copy at Amazon
